Frequently Asked Questions About Property in Puerto de Mazarrón

Puerto de Mazarrón is a lively coastal town on the Costa Cálida with a beautiful marina, a wide sandy beach and a great choice of seafront restaurants and bars. It has a genuine year-round community and a good range of amenities, from supermarkets and medical facilities to sports clubs and local markets. It offers the best of both worlds: a real Spanish town feel combined with a beach and marina lifestyle.
The property market in Puerto de Mazarrón includes apartments and townhouses close to the beach and marina, along with detached villas and bungalows on surrounding urbanisations. There is a wide range of price points, from compact holiday apartments to larger family villas with private pools. New build options are also available in some areas close to the town.
Yes. Puerto de Mazarrón has a well-established year-round population, including a significant international community. Unlike some purely seasonal resort towns, it has sufficient local infrastructure to support comfortable living throughout the year, with shops, health services and community life active outside of the peak summer months.
Puerto de Mazarrón has a long, wide sandy beach that is well-maintained and sheltered, making it suitable for families and swimming from spring through to autumn. The nearby beach at Bolnuevo, just a few kilometres along the coast, is also popular and is known for its dramatic rock formations and calm, clear water.
Murcia International Airport (Corvera) is approximately 35 to 45 minutes from Puerto de Mazarrón by car, with regular direct flights from many UK airports. Alicante-Elche Airport is also an option at approximately 90 minutes by road, offering a broader range of routes and airlines.
